What Is a Stroller?

A stroller is a type of vehicle with wheels, which parents use to move their infants or toddlers around. Strollers come in many different designs, including full-size models, convertible models, as well as jogging strollers.

Some models can be used by toddlers and newborns. Check with your pediatrician to determine the recommended age range of the stroller.

Safety

A stroller should be a safe and secure place for a child, which is why safety features are essential. A high-quality stroller will have an incredibly sturdy harness that can restrain your baby and a strong canopy that will shield your baby from the rain, sun or snow. Find a parking brake that is easy to use and secures both wheels. This is essential, especially when your child has a good grasp on the brake levers.

In addition to locking the wheels, a top-quality stroller should have an crotch strap that prevents toddlers and infants from sliding out. This should be a thick, wide strap. Beware of models that allow children to bypass the crotch strap or unintentionally pull it off which could put them at risk of serious injuries.

Before they can be sold strollers must be able to pass a stability test on an inclined platform. This ensures that the stroller won't tip over when in use, even with an entire load of children and other cargo. Some models have an indicator built in that tells you if your stroller is unstable and requires a leveling before you can walk.

It's also an excellent idea to avoid hanging heavy objects on the handlebars, as they could cause the stroller to tip over. Inflatable toys and other things are also a hazard, as they can easily be caught on moving parts or be pulled over the top of the stroller.

Another safety issue is the fabric that could trap toys and other items inside the canopy. Certain models come with mesh or plastic inserts to prevent this. You should also look at the buckle on the harness to ensure that it's not too difficult for a toddler to remove the buckle. A five-point harness is thought to be the safest, as it secures a child at the shoulders and between the legs, instead of just around the waist.

Avoid taking your stroller up and down the stairs or in an elevator, as it could be dangerous for you baby. Instead, carry your kid or seek help if necessary.

Comfort

A stroller can make long walks easier for a baby by providing a relaxing ride. The best strollers have a well-padded seat and suspension that helps reduce bumps, jolts, as well as shocks. It is recommended to choose a stroller that has the ability to recline so that you can alter the position of the child's head and back.

A large canopy can help protect your baby from the sun. It's also important to think about the size of your child's body when shopping for a stroller newborn. If your child is small, a stroller with an infant car seat may be the best choice. If your toddler is active, a stroller compact with a larger seating area and more storage might be better.

A stroller that has an adjustable handlebar is a crucial feature for parents of varying heights. The handlebar should be comfortable to hold, allowing you to push the stroller without straining your arms or shoulders. A good stroller also has brakes and swivel lock mechanisms that are simple to operate and quick to respond.

Check the stroller out before you buy it. Move it around, turn it and check that the brakes and swivel locks are dependable and secure. Convenience

Strollers allow parents to go out and about without worrying about the safety of their child. Strollers are designed to be easy to steer so that parents can easily navigate the crowded sidewalks and parking lots. Some strollers come with extra features, like sun canopies or adjustable seating to make them more comfortable for babies and toddlers.

While strollers aren't essential for all parents, they can be a valuable convenience for a lot of families. The ideal stroller for your needs is determined by numerous factors, including your life style, living conditions, and the needs of your infant.

It is crucial to select the right stroller that suits your family's requirements. If you plan on using it for long walks or hikes consider one with high-quality tires that can withstand the terrain. It should also include a recline that is deep or a bassinet options for infants. If you plan on jogging choose one that is designed for jogging or comes with an attachment for jogging. If you will be taking your infant car seat or toddler car seat along pick an infant stroller with a secure, sturdy harness system that comes with an Crotch strap.

Another thing to think about is cup holders. They can be extremely useful when you're in motion and want to keep your drinks handy so that you don't have to stop for a drink. Some strollers have the ability to peek out which is useful to keep an eye on your child.
